Commercial Slab Installation in Bellingham, WA

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for various types of structures, including retail stores, warehouses, garages, and other commercial buildings. This process typically includes site preparation, leveling, and ensuring a stable base to support heavy loads and long-term use. Property owners often request this service when constructing new commercial spaces or expanding existing facilities, and they usually want to understand the scope of work, materials used, and how the foundation will support their specific project needs.

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and design of the structure, soil conditions,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It’s also important to discuss the intended use of the space, as this can influence the thickness and reinforcement requirements of the slab. Clear communication about project expectations and site conditions can help ensure the installation meets the necessary standards for safety and durability.

Project Types

Common Commercial Slab Installation Jobs

Commercial slab installation involves preparing and pouring concrete slabs for various business and industrial structures.

Parking lot slabs are designed to provide durable surfaces for vehicle access and parking areas.

Sidewalk and walkway slabs create safe, level walkways around commercial properties.

Loading dock slabs support heavy equipment and facilitate efficient loading and unloading processes.

Foundation slabs form the base for new commercial buildings, ensuring stability and longevity.

Industrial flooring slabs are built to withstand heavy machinery and high traffic environments.

FAQ

Commercial Slab Installation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on business properties.

What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It's important to evaluate soil conditions, drainage needs, and the intended use to ensure proper design and durability.

How long does a typical commercial slab installation take? Installation durations vary based on size and site conditions, but planning for proper preparation and curing is essential.

What are common materials used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material, often reinforced with steel for added strength and longevity.
